![]() According to a report filed in Real Trends, a desktop online real estate news service, the United States ranked number one on the list of the most frequent locations for employees sent on international assignments. The information was obtained in a report by Cendant Mobility and based on the company's data, tracking global transfer activity on behalf of more than 1,700 clients. The top 10 hottest countries for international transfers, according to Cendant Mobility, are: 1. United States 2. United Kingdom 3. Singapore 4. Mexico 5. Hong Kong 6. China 7. Indonesia 8. Canada 9. India 10. Saudi Arabia Cendant is the world's premier franchisor of real estate brokerage offices, a major provider of mortgage services and a global leader in corporate relocation services.
